Nationally, the government has asked local authorities, including Gloucestershire, to transform children’s services so that families feel more supported, safe and listened to. Here in Gloucestershire, we are responding to this by introducing a new way of working: the Families First Partnership (FFP) Programme.
The Families First Partnership Programme is designed to transform the whole system of help, support and protection, so that every child and family can get the right support at the right time. This means a stronger focus on getting help earlier, preventing issues from growing to crisis point, and making the experience of accessing support clearer, smoother and more connected.
